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
19 34916381 19297908 837460
641449688 47296421 08629785466
641449688 47296421 08629785466
033036 027333 43 54594228164
All about undefined
Interested in learning more?
641449688 47296421 08629785466
033036 027333 43 54594228164
See more
363315326 220860 4827007
88047788284 58690 5930332311 28
See more
919371213 191 00008559
7254 711139 750
See more